The ramen’s salty flavor comes from the shoyu tare (sauce), and never from the soup broth. If you taste the tare, you’d discover it’s extraordinarily salty. Adjust the quantity of the shoyu tare for the measured soup broth in your ramen bowl. Even though it’s a simple recipe, you will spend 6 hours simmering this ramen soup broth.

Just a quantity of years ago, the entire craze of mukbanging — a Korean word which means “broadcast eating” — wasn’t a thing that had infiltrated YouTube. But, quickly the belief was made that lots of people take pleasure in watching videos of others merely consuming in front of their digicam. Mukbangers deal with audiences to all types of cuisine, from decadent desserts to hearty steaks. Watch enough of the movies on the market, and you will come to realize that immediate ramen is super prevalent. Maybe it’s one thing concerning the slurping noises that hit sure ASMR triggers. Either method, immediate ramen has carved out an enormous place within the mukbang landscape.

There have been lots of tales about emergency room docs calling for immediate noodle cups to be banned or to be redesigned. A lot of individuals, primarily kids, have been ending up within the emergency room after being given a boiling scorching cup of immediate noodles. Images of the angle required for the cups to tip over have been shown for instance that they are prime heavy. Sure, you set pretty much anything on an unsteady floor and it will fall off.

It’s most likely a protected wager that everybody has no much less than tried ramen as quickly as in their life.
The noodles can also be cooked in a microwave, which is why they’re usually a staple food for college college students dwelling in dormitories. You can discover ramen noodles in every nook of the nation and in seemingly endless regional variations. Head north to Sapporo to strive miso ramen topped with a slice of butter, or south to Kagoshima for porky tonkotsu ramen with hints of hen and sardine stock. Japanese ramen has gone from humble Chinese immigrant meals to worldwide phenomenon, with chefs now making artisan bowls with top-quality ingredients. Ramen is certainly one of Japan’s most necessary comfort meals and belongs on any Japanese food bucket listing.

While conventional ramen uses wheat noodles, you can experiment with several types of noodles, such as udon, soba, or egg noodles, if you prefer or have dietary restrictions. Yes, you can also make vegetarian or vegan ramen through the use of vegetable stock as a base and adding plant-based proteins like tofu or tempeh. You can even incorporate quite so much of vegetables and mushrooms for flavor and texture.
